Default Truck died yesterday, got some codes for you guys..

Posted about my 03 with a 5.7 Hemi. Pulled the codes and they are as follows:

0456- Gascap
0440- also cap
0344- camshaft sensor, my friends tester said intermittent..
2108- dunno, didn't come up on obd-codes.com
2106- also didn't come up

I'm going to start by pulling my TB and giving it a good cleaning.. Any other suggestions?

2108 is for the electronic throttle control. Chances are that it needs to be cleaned,
the best way to clean the TB is to remove it. Use non-chlorinated brake cleaner

DO NOT FORCE THE THROTTLE PLATE---LEAVE IT CLOSED WHILE YOU'RE CLEANING IT.

2106 is not listed

The gas cap dtc may also be caused by evap system leaks, usually caused by dried or rotting rubber hoses at the charchol canister and the solenoid (up front). Its best to inspect the whole evap system--(easy)--and replace any hoses that are even cracked.
